Psychopathology in children of inpatients with depression: a controlled study.

Z Welner, A Welner, M D McCrary, M A Leonard.   

Abstract

One quarter of 29 parents hospitalized for depression had children with episodes of depression (eight out of a total of 75 children). None of the children in 41 families with well parents had episodes of depression (a total of 152 children). The differences were significant at the .01 level. It is suggested that symptoms "equivalent" to depression such as hyperactivity, deviant behavior, and learning difficulties are not required in establishing clinical depression in childhood. The methodological shortcomings in this study were discussed.
